💧 Water Conservation Request Continues – Areas South of Dickinson

Southwest Water Authority is asking customers south, southeast, and southwest of Dickinson, including the communities we serve in these areas, to continue conserving water during the week of August 24.

While water service remains available, our system needs time to catch up with demand and refill storage reservoirs throughout the area.

We ask customers to please limit non-essential water use where possible. Reducing demand now will help our reservoirs recover and ensure adequate water remains available throughout the system.

Thank you for your patience, cooperation, and help in keeping water flowing throughout southwest North Dakota. 💧

Southwest Water Authority

Here at Southwest Water Authority (SWA), we provide award-winning water to the residents of southwest North Dakota and Perkins County, South Dakota. SWA is responsible for the management, operations and maintenance of the Southwest Pipeline Project (SWPP), which is state owned and administered by the North Dakota State Water Commission. The SWPP transports raw water from Lake Sakakawea to the Dickinson Water Treatment Plant (WTP), the Southwest WTP and the OMND WTP where it is treated and delivered to SWA’s customers.
